Hello from Norma in White City OR.  I am a retired person who hates to sit(or stand) and do nothing.

When I first moved in here 11 years ago, I worked a lot in getting lawns and gardens, raised flower beds, fences and gates, etc, established. 

About 3 1/2 (or so) years ago, I mentioned to my brother - LA CA - that I wanted to do some scroll sawing.  Well, he bought me one.  Nice guy, my brother.  Anyway, as usual one thing lead to another and I acqired a disc sander, an air cleaner and more goodies.   I was doing all this in my "craft room", in the house.  Needless to say, I ran out of room with sewing machine, computer desk and all in the same room.  A friend, down the street is a woodworker and started cutting pieces of wood, helped me buy my first board of maple and just essentially get me started.  He made a suggestion that I think he regrets to this day as to why I didn't take my shed and make it a wood shop.    Well, I'll give you three guess as to what happened next........but the first two don't count.

I lined the walls with insulation - ceiling, too, then put mdf up over that, put in two windows, painted the floor and he put in the electric, put the mdf ceiling up and the ends of the walls.  Yes, he is still

my friend (I think) cutting my wood for me (and do I appreciate it), his wife and I are good friends and I am proceeding to learn on each piece I do.  After about 3 years, I felt confidant enough to show people what I am doing, and would you believe it?  I have sold a few pieces.  Surprised - and pleased - my socks off!!!!

Any way, making boxes and even have "designed" a few patterns myself.  Just came in from getting set up to do 2 more 5" boxes, some smaller boxes and a pair of owl trivets that are sold. 

I don't know of anyone in my area that scroll saws and if they are out there, they are pretty closed mouthed about it. 

So happy to find this web site and "talk" to a few people having the same interest.
